TMS Records Sixth-Consecutive Month Of 100,000-Plus Sales
2 September 1998
TMS Records Sixth-Consecutive Month Of 100,000-Plus Sales; Toyota And Lexus Divisions Report Best-Ever AugustTORRANCE, Calif., Sept. 1 -- Toyota Motor Sales (TMS), U.S.A., Inc., reported today best-ever August sales of 130,814 vehicles, up 10.9 percent over last year. Calendar-year-to-date (CYTD) sales total 888,640, an increase of 3.8 percent compared to the same period last year. The Toyota Division recorded sales of 113,865, up 6.5 percent from last August, marking the first time in the company's history that Toyota Division sales topped 100,000 vehicles four months-in-a-row. Total August sales also gave TMS a record-breaking six-consecutive months of 100,000-plus sales and the company's second best-ever sales month. Lexus Division CYTD sales totaled 100,000 units which surpasses the total number of vehicles sold in all of calendar year 1997. The Lexus Division also set an all-time sales record of 16,949 vehicles, an increase of 52.5 percent over August 1997, while combined Toyota and Lexus light truck sales enjoyed a best-ever August with sales of 48,449, up 19.8 percent. With August sales of 40,553, Camry jumped ahead of Honda Accord for the year, and also was the Toyota car sales leader for the month. Corolla was up 9.7 percent to 23,580, and Avalon increased 26.3 percent to 7,392. Toyota Division light truck sales highlights include Sienna which had the best-ever August for a Toyota van with sales of 7,421. Tacoma 2WD pickup sales rose 13.4 percent to 8,233, while total compact pickup truck sales for August increased 7.4 percent to 15,582 compared to the same period last year. The all-new Toyota Land Cruiser also posted increased sales of 1,376, up 35.3 percent. The Lexus Division's record-setting month was led by the new RX 300 sport utility vehicle, which sold 5,455 units. The LX 470 increased August sales by 57.4 percent, to 1,300 units, and sales of the luxury division's flagship sedan, the LS 400, rose 3.7 percent to 2,080. Sales of North American-built vehicles made up 61.5 percent of total August sales, up from 57.5 percent the previous year.
